LANGUAGE – Mandarin opens up new opportunities

More and more young Malagasy people are turning to the Chinese language to broaden their future prospects. This trend is confirmed at the Confucius Institute of the University of Antananarivo, where 136 students received their Bachelor’s degrees in Chinese language and culture last Friday in Ankatso. These new graduates now intend to apply their skills in the professional world.

“The goal of learning Chinese is to expand my knowledge so that I am not limited to the opportunities offered only in Madagascar. That is why I chose this field, and I fully intend to continue my studies,” says Sandatiana, one of the graduates of the ‘Hiratra’ class.

“This 2026 cohort is particularly distinguished by the excellence of its results. The academic level has reached new heights this year, marked by high grades and a significant increase in the averages obtained by the top students,” according to Prisca Maroy Rasoanirina, the Malagasy director of the Confucius Institute at the University of Antananarivo.

Beyond academic excellence, the Confucius Institute confirms its attractiveness to Malagasy youth. “The figures speak for themselves: the institution has recorded a strong increase in its first-year (L1) enrollment, rising from 300 students last year to 350 for this academic year,” the director added.
